Mary Josephine Vozenilek Obituary

Mary Josephine Vozenilek, nee Mensik of Stickney passed away on July 4, 2024 at McNeal Hospital in Berwyn. She was born in Chicago on November 12, 1941 to John & Josephine Mensik. She was preceded in death by her parents.  Loving mother of the late Anne (Greg) Mulroe and their child Sarah Mulroe; Anthony(Sharon) Vozenilek and children Ryan, Joshua, and Luke; George(Jeanine) Vozenilek and children Bianca, Matt, and Nina; Joanna (Kirk) Nauman, and children Kala, Kody, and Sam. She was a loving wife, mother, grandmother, sister, aunt, and friend to many.

Mary & George were married October 20, 1962 on Sweetest Day. They celebrated 61 years last October. Mary wore many hats throughout her life.  She graduated nursing school in 1962, she was a Licensed massage therapist for many years, she was a co-owner in a family business called Czech Kitchens where they carried on her mother's legacy of making Josie's dumplings and other ethnic food. She was proud of her Czech heritage and was a member of the Moravian Cultural Society for most of her life.  Her greatest loves though were her grandchildren. She was the happiest when she was spending time with them whether it was making Christmas cookies, decorating Easter eggs, taking them on shopping trips to buy Christmas presents for their parents, or even taking them to see a movie. She would do anything to put a smile on their faces including sending many special gifts whenever she could. She was the Jello queen and brought it to every family party. She also loved Weber Bakery and would bring it for all to enjoy because it’s the best bakery in Chicago. She was the best Mom and Grandmother anyone could ask for.

Mary loved to read and was a huge Harry Potter fan. I don't think a day went by that she didn't read her horoscope as she was a believer in the stars as she was a true Scorpio. If you knew Mary, you knew all about Mercury being in retrograde and she would make sure you didn't buy a car or other big purchases. She loved word games and played them often on her phone as well as Sudoku in every Sunday paper. Although, I don't think anything came close to her love of lotto and scratchy lotto tickets. It was one of her goals in life, to win the millions to share with her family. I hope they have lotto, lightning, or bingo in Heaven because that's where you'll find her.  

Mary could make friends in a closet and loved to chat. She had the biggest heart and loved to take care of everyone around her. She will be missed by all who knew her and we know she was met by her daughter Anne and her parents with open arms in Heaven. Until we meet again, we love you.

A visitation will be held on Friday July 19, 2024 from 4pm to 8pm at Avenue Christian Church, 5750 Holmes Ave, Clarendon Hills, IL 60514. Family and friends will meet at the church on Saturday July 20, 2024 for a 10 am visitation until time of funeral service at 11am. Private Interment will follow at Queen of Heaven Cemetery.
